Notes

'This package consists of previously released material.'

Serj's Poem on the cover of side B goes as follow:

"★Contraband contradictions, concocting contractions conceding to caucasian caucases causing casual conclusions concerning inconclusive karma, masking masochistic mosquito massages in masculine mosques, a must see mosaic ! Take your tartar sauce, and your Tinseltown tactics to a Tic-Tac filled trumpet and blow. Enjoy the eloquent essence of esoteric engines humming in Ecstasy, Etc. Actual arctic acronyms were asked to ascertain the astral auspices of acting astericks, that's ass! She sells sea shells BUY THE REAL WH★RE !"

Track 13 (Side C - Track 4) 'F**k The System' is misspelled 'F*** The System' on Lyrics Sheet.

"I-E-A-I-A-I-O" contains interpolations from "Knight Rider" written by Stu Phillips and Glen Larson. Courtesy of Songs Of Universal, Inc (BMI)

Recording location: Cello Studios, Los Angeles CA and Akademie Mathematique of Philosophical Sound Research, Los Angeles, CA.

Mixed at Enterprise Studios, Burbank, CA and Akademie Mathematique of Philosophical Sound Research, Los Angeles, CA.

Mastered at Sony Music Studios

All songs © 2002 Sony/ATV Tunes LLC and DDevil Music.
All rights istered by Sony / ATV Music Publishing.

©2002, 2018 & ℗2002 Columbia Records.
